Biography of Peacock: From Concept to Launch
Peacock, NBCUniversal's flagship streaming service, was conceived as a response to the growing demand for on-demand content in an increasingly digital world. The idea for Peacock was first announced in January 2019, with NBCUniversal aiming to create a platform that would not only showcase its extensive library of content but also offer something unique to viewers. Unlike many of its competitors, Peacock was designed to cater to a wide range of audiences, from casual viewers looking for free content to avid streamers willing to pay for premium features. The platform officially launched in the United States on April 15, 2020, and quickly gained traction due to its innovative approach to content delivery and monetization.

Peacock's development was heavily influenced by NBCUniversal's decades-long legacy in the entertainment industry. The platform's name, inspired by the iconic peacock logo of NBC, symbolizes the brand's commitment to quality and innovation. From its inception, Peacock was envisioned as more than just a streaming service—it was designed to be a hub for live sports, original programming, and nostalgic favorites. The platform's unique hybrid model, which combines free, ad-supported tiers with premium subscription options, reflects NBCUniversal's understanding of consumer preferences in a rapidly changing media landscape.

How Does Peacock Generate Revenue?
Peacock's revenue streams are as diverse as its content offerings, reflecting the platform's strategic approach to monetization. At the core of its financial strategy is a combination of subscription fees, advertising revenue, and partnerships with other media companies. The subscription model is divided into two primary tiers: Peacock Premium and Peacock Premium Plus. Peacock Premium, available for a modest monthly fee, offers users access to a vast library of content, including original programming, live sports, and NBCUniversal classics. For those seeking an entirely ad-free experience, Peacock Premium Plus provides an enhanced tier with additional perks, such as offline downloads and early access to new releases. These subscription tiers are a significant contributor to Peacock net worth, ensuring a steady flow of recurring revenue from loyal users.

How Do Partnerships and Licensing Contribute to Peacock's Financial Success?
In addition to subscriptions and advertising, partnerships and licensing agreements play a vital role in Peacock's revenue generation. The platform has secured exclusive rights to popular content, such as Premier League matches and WWE events, which not only attract sports enthusiasts but also open up additional revenue streams through licensing deals. Furthermore, Peacock collaborates with other media companies to co-produce original content, sharing costs and risks while maximizing returns. These strategic partnerships enhance Peacock net worth by diversifying its income sources and ensuring a steady influx of high-quality content that keeps users engaged and subscribed.
